Description
English: object type / vase shape: Apulian red figure volute-krater

- description neck A: Athena, Herakles with club fighting Geryoneus, Nike crowning Herakles, Hermes - neck B: Boread, Medea with phrygian cap holding cista, Iason with petasos and spear, warrior with spear, Boread - body A: Meleagros and others hunting the Calydonian boar - body B: youth, woman, Pegasos, Athena seated, Hermes, Pan; Bellerophon with spear killing the Chimaira, helped by 3 amazons - foot (worked separately): Nereids riding on kete and dolphins - production place: Apulia - painter: (Trendall: probably near the) Underworld Painter - period / date: late classical/ early hellenistic, ca. 330-310 BC - material: pottery (clay) - findspot: Ceglie del Campo - museum / inventory number: Berlin, Altes Museum (Antikensammlung) F 3258 - bibliography: Arthur Dale Trendall, Alexander Cambitoglou, The red-figured vases of Apulia volume I and II, Oxford 1978, cat. 18/unnumbered, page 533 - Ursula Kästner, David Saunders, Gefährliche Perfektion. Antike Grabvasen aus Apulien, Berlin 2016, fig. 24-27
